At its core, editing Insta360 videos on a PC revolves around three technical pillars: **format conversion, spatial editing, and platform optimization**. The first step—converting `.INSV` files to editable formats—often involves Insta360 Studio, which extracts spherical metadata and converts footage into equirectangular projections (a flattened 360° map). This is critical because most PC software (like Premiere Pro or Final Cut Pro) can’t natively read `.INSV` files without this conversion. Skipping this step risks losing stitching data, which is essential for accurate stabilization and framing. Once converted, the real work begins: spatial editing. Unlike flat videos, where you can simply trim and rearrange clips, 360° editing requires accounting for the viewer’s potential movement. Tools like Adobe’s 360° VR tools or Insta360’s plugin allow you to define "safe zones" (areas of the frame where critical content must remain visible) and apply effects that adapt to spherical geometry. For example, a text overlay must be placed in a way that remains legible regardless of where the viewer looks. The final stage—platform optimization—involves adjusting resolution, frame rate, and even audio balance to meet the technical specs of YouTube VR, Facebook 360, or other delivery systems.Key Benefits and Crucial Impact

Q: Can I edit Insta360 videos on a PC without Insta360 Studio?
A: Technically yes, but you’ll lose access to critical features like automatic stitching correction and `.INSV` file conversion. Most PC software (Premiere Pro, Final Cut) requires these files to be pre-processed in Insta360 Studio or a similar tool. Skipping this step risks stitching artifacts and metadata loss.

Q: How do I stabilize Insta360 footage on a PC?
A: Use Insta360 Studio’s stabilization tools first, then refine in Premiere Pro with the Warp Stabilizer effect (set to "Spherical" mode). For extreme shakes, consider third-party plugins like Mettle Skybox or Topaz Video AI’s stabilization module. Always preview in VR to ensure the effect holds up for viewers.
Q: Can I edit Insta360 videos for flat social media (e.g., Instagram Reels)?
A: Yes, but you’ll need to flatten the 360° projection into a 2D frame using Insta360 Studio’s "Flat" export option. Choose a POV (e.g., first-person or fixed wide-angle) and adjust the resolution to fit platform requirements. Avoid cropping too tightly—viewers should still recognize it as 360° content.

Q: How do I add subtitles to Insta360 videos for PC editing?
A: Use Premiere Pro’s built-in subtitling tools, but place text in a "safe zone" (e.g., the center of the equirectangular map) to ensure visibility from any viewing angle. For VR headsets, consider using floating subtitles that follow the viewer’s gaze. Avoid edge-of-frame text—it’ll be invisible in many perspectives.
